Understanding Concrete Mixes
Concrete mixes are like the secret sauce for your foundation. Get this right, and you’ve got a sturdy base for your home—or a recipe for disaster. Knowing the types of mixes and their components helps guarantee your structure won’t turn into a wobbly Jenga tower.
Types of Concrete Mixes
You’ve got options. The most common types include:
- Standard Mix: Great for general use, it typically comprises a ratio of 1 part cement, 2 parts sand, and 3 parts gravel. It achieves about 3,000 psi (pounds per square inch) strength after curing, which is solid for most projects.
- High-Strength Mix: This baby packs a punch! Designed for heavy structural applications, it features a 1:2:4 ratio and can achieve strengths of 5,000 psi or greater. Useful in high-rise buildings or bridges.
- Lightweight Mix: It uses lightweight aggregates, making it easier to handle while providing decent strength. It weighs around 20% less than standard mixes.

Components of Concrete Mix
Concrete isn’t just some gooey mess. Its key components are:
- Cement: The glue that holds it all together. Portland cement is the most common choice. A 94-pound bag yields about 3 cubic feet of concrete.
- Aggregates: These include sand, gravel, and crushed stone. They make up roughly 60-75% of the mix. The more, the merrier—just ensure it’s clean.
- Water: You can’t forget the H2O! Ideal water-to-cement ratios hover between 0.4 and 0.6. Too much water, and you’ll weaken the mix.
- Additives: Optional ingredients like superplasticizers improve workability, while accelerators help set it faster. Just don’t go overboard; a little goes a long way!

Load-Bearing Capacity
Load-bearing capacity defines how much weight your foundation can support. Standard mixes can typically handle around 2,500 to 5,000 psi (pounds per square inch), which suits most residential buildings. For heavy loads, aim for high-strength mixes that reach up to 10,000 psi. Environmental Considerations
Environmental factors play a crucial role, too. Is it raining? Hot and dry? Your mix may need some adjustments. Hot temperatures can lead to rapid evaporation of water, which can mess with your mix. A water-to-cement ratio of 0.4 to 0.6 is preferred for good workability.
Local climate conditions can also dictate whether you need additives, such as retarders for hot weather or accelerators for chilly days. Using additives can enhance durability and help your mix endure those unexpected weather tantrums.
If you’re tracking concrete’s carbon footprint, consider green alternatives like recycled aggregates. These options can reduce waste and sometimes improve performance. Your foundation shouldn’t just hold up your house; it should also feel environmentally friendly while doing so.

Standard Mix Ratios
For most home foundations, the standard concrete mix ratio of 1:2:3 works wonders. That means one part cement, two parts sand, and three parts gravel. Water usually gets added at about half the weight of cement, but adjust as needed for workability.

Specialty Mix Options
Sometimes, you need something spicier. High-strength mixes pack a punch with ratios like 1:1.5:3 and can deliver strengths of up to 10,000 psi. These are perfect for heavy-duty applications such as commercial slabs and high-stress environments.
Lightweight mixes, with aggregates like expanded clay or polystyrene, reduce weight without sacrificing strength. Ideal for structures that can’t bear too much load, these mixes enable construction while sipping cocktails.
You can also look into mixes with additives. For instance, fly ash or slag can enhance durability and reduce the carbon footprint. Using these greener options helps mother nature while you pour.

Over-Watering the Mix
Sloppy mixing isn’t just a bad idea; it leads to weak foundations. You might think splashing in extra water makes it easier to work with, but you’re mixing disaster!
A mix with too much water turns concrete into a soggy sponge. Instead of achieving a strong bond, you’re setting yourself up for cracking and shrinking. A standard water-cement ratio is around 0.4 to 0.6 for optimal strength. Stick to this, and your foundation will thank you.
Ignoring Weather Conditions
Weather forecasts aren’t just for planning your picnic. They play a crucial role in pouring concrete too! Pouring concrete on a sweltering summer day? Better keep an eye on hydration.
Extremely hot conditions can dry out your mix faster than a sandcastle at low tide. On the flip side, pouring during freezing temperatures affects curing time, resulting in weaker strength. Pouring concrete in temps below 40°F (4°C) is a hard “no.” Plan your pours accordingly, and you’ll save yourself a lot of headaches.
